RAC: Petrol and diesel price cut must come this week after further drop in wholesale costs

Tuesday, 30 November 2021 00:01

RAC warns retailers will lose ‘all credibility’ with drivers if they don’t pass on wholesale savings at the pumps Average retailer margin stands at 19p a litre for petrol and 15p for diesel – making unleaded 12p a litre too expensive and diesel 10p too dear Retailers must cut the price of petrol and diesel this week or risk losing all credibility with drivers, the RAC is warning.
